What do the results of genetic test mean?

A genetic test result can be positive, negative, or uncertain.

  • Positive result- A positive result implies the presence of a genetic abnormality or genetic mutation in one or more genes. A positive result indicates that you are at a greater risk of developing a hereditary disorder. Such a result will help your doctor in providing with early treatment measures.
  • Negative result– A negative test result simply means that no defective gene was identified upon analysis. However, a negative result does not rule out the absence or risk of a genetic condition because of the presence of undetected genes.
  • Uncertain result– An uncertain result is when one or more gene variants are found, but it is unclear whether the gene variants could cause of a  genetic disease or if they are a normal part of the person’s genetic framework. Uncertain results are usually common, especially when more number of genes are analyzed.
